The Railhopper migration replaces our homegrown job queue with the managed Conveyant dispatch API. Support staff should know that enqueue calls now return a durable receipt token rather than a numeric job ID, and retries are handled server-side with exponential backoff capped at ten minutes. When reproducing customer issues in the staging sandbox, all requests must be authenticated against the internal Conveyant gateway. The key authorized for support-team diagnostics is provided below.

service key, fawip-bajef: kto11_Qt5wZK9vdNC

// REINDEX_BATCH_CAP limits docs per shard pass in the Tallowfield
// nightly search reindex. Raising it starves the ingest queue;
// lowering it overruns the maintenance window. 5000 is the tested
// sweet spot. Change only with a soak run. Verified against the
// build noted below.

session token of bawif-hahog = htk6_ac5981

Meeting notes (excerpt) — locked case of test devices

Quick recap from this morning: the locked case of Brellin Labs test handsets is ready on rack B. Jora confirmed the inventory count matches the manifest, so no need to reopen it — the lock stays on until it reaches the Fenwick lab. Courier is booked for 2pm. When they arrive, handle the hand-over per the confidential instruction below.

dispatch memo: the eliok quenok courier leaves the sorael aldath belion tammir casix gileth queniel jorath ledger at gate 9299 under passcode 897989

Handover: Marek is taking over SDK parity work for the Lumenflow client libraries. The Kotlin SDK now matches the Swift SDK on retry semantics and pagination; streaming upload remains Swift-only until Q3. Plugin authors should target the shared interface and avoid platform-specific hooks. Before testing your plugin, apply the service configuration values listed below.

service settings:
novath:
  pin: 1396
  tenant: pelys
  seal: seal_ccc035e1
  metrics_host: metrics.novath.qorvelworks.test
  standby_team: fraeth
  escalation: drueth-zorok
  nonce: 61d508